This is a review of our 14-day South American cruise aboard Celebrity's Infinity from Valparaiso, Chile to Buenos Aires, Argentina. Our embarkation day was February 1, 2004. My wife (40), daughter (2) and I (39) were on cabin 9164 (cat CC). This was our ninth cruise, third on Celebrity, and second aboard the Infinity.

SUMMARY This cruise has to rate near the top when compared to all the other cruises we have taken. The itinerary was excellent, providing a balance between ports and days at sea. The scenery encountered during our passage through the Chilean fjords and the Strait of Magellan was truly spectacular, and made our balcony cabin a wise investment. The weather was great with only one day of rain during the whole trip. We used local tour operators during our cruise, rather than taking the ship excursions in all ports except the Falkland Islands. More on the individual tour operators down below. THE TRIP January 27: Our flight from Orlando to Santiago, Chile (via Miami) was on LAN Chile. We had a great overnight arriving in Santiago early the next morning.

January 28: Santiago. Please note that you must pay an entry fee of $100 when arriving by plane in Chile. This amount must be paid before passing Chilean customs. We took a taxi from the airport to our hotel. The Hotel Carrera, once the best hotel in Santiago, had been sold and was to be closed at the end of February. That made our 2-night stay a little surreal, as furniture auctions were been held every day. However, the service was fine and we had a pleasant stay in the hotel. We arranged a city tour with SportsTour Chile, and had great full day tour with our guide.
